    Quote Originally Posted by MRMOPARMAN
    hey coronac, if your thinking of doing injection on the cheap ive seen some good results from using the EFI system out of a centrepoint injected EA/EB falcon. cos its throttle body injected you could make an adapter and do a few mods to the stock manifold and it would bolt up, they have the fuel lines and return lines, TPS, idle up all built in. make a hat for it wire it up and away you go.

    the only unknown is the injectiors, they use 2 huge ones and they supply a 3.9l N/A engine ok, so maybe it will do for a 1.2l turbs?

    been looking into doing this exact thing on a 4k corolla.. too many projects damnit

    ive made to suck thru turbs setup one in my ta22 runing 15 - 20psi ran good till it crack a pistion, and then suck thru setup on my rolla with the 3T agian but running 8psi, both times using a CD175 srongburg carby, but now looking at runing a 2'' SU for more flow, and also making a blow thru weber setup also, and a turbs 302windsor with a blowthru holley near the end of the year

    so far ive been able to do it alot cheaper than if i ran EFI, and its beeen goin hard, so im in no way even thinking of goin to EFI and i can rebuild and tune the carbys my self so thats good. so yeah setup is easy, it goe hard, once its up and running and tune right it fine after that

    carbys all the way for me
